    Abstract: A robust nonnegative matrix factorization (RNMF) method, in which an image sample set is split into a training set and a test set. The training set and the test set are normalized to map the image data from [0, 255] to [0, 1]. The training set matrix is pretrained by RNMF for decomposition. l2,1-deep incremental nonnegative matrix factorization (l2,1-DINMF) model is construed. The l2,1-DINMF model is configured to decompose the training set matrix into l+1 factors. After the basis matrix has been updated, and the samples of the training set and samples to be recognized are projected into a feature space. Feature representations of the test set are classified by a trained SVM classifier to obtain a predicted label, and the predicted label is compared with an actual label of the test set to calculate a recognition accuracy.
